Hungarian Cucumbers

List of Ingredients
- 6 cucumbers, peeled and sliced paper THIN
- Salt to taste
- 3 cloves of garlic, minced
- 3 Tbsp White Vinegar
- 1 Cup Sour Cream
- Hot Hungarian Paprika (to taste)
Instructions
- Slice the cucumbers PAPER THIN. Use a mandelion if possible - Just remember --- PAPER THIN!
- Salt the cucumber slices to taste.
- Allow the salted cucumbers to stand for 30 minutes.
- Hand squeeze the excess liquid from the cucumbers.
- In a seperate bowl mix together the sourcream, vinegar and minced garlic. Mix well
- Now add the sour cream mix to the cucumbers. Stir it all together.
- Chill prior to serving.
- Prior to serving sprinkle the cucumbers with Hungarian paprika for color and taste.
Final Comments
Two tips - REMEMBER PAPER THIN!!!! Also work at getting the excess liquid off the cucumbers.
